The Northland Grassroots Fund grants around $90,000 each year to worthy causes and charities in Northland. Organisations can apply for a grant of up to $15,000.

Northland Community Foundation acts as a Local Donation Manager for The Tindall Foundation, a philanthropic family foundation working throughout Aotearoa to support whānau/families, hapori/community and te taiao/the environment.  We distribute donations on behalf of The Tindall Foundation to projects and initiatives that support The Tindall Foundation Family/Whānau Focus Area within Te Tai Tokerau Northland.  The funds provided by The Tindall Foundation are boosted by donations made to Northland Community Foundation’s Northland Grassroots Fund.
